For over a thousand years, the coca leaf has been deeply woven into the cultural, medicinal, and spiritual lives of Indigenous South Americans. But from ancient rituals to modern addiction, its story is anything but simple. In this episode of Info On The Go, we trace the journey of Erythroxylum coca—from sacred leaf to scientific marvel, from colonial exploitation to a central figure in the modern drug trade.

We’ll uncover archaeological clues of coca’s ancient use in trepanation surgeries, reveal how European scientists unlocked its potent alkaloids, and examine how early pharmaceutical companies marketed cocaine as a wonder drug for everything from fatigue to heartbreak. You’ll also learn about the surprising links between Freud and eye surgery, Sherlock Holmes and drugstores, and how a stimulant from the Andes found its way into Victorian literature, World War II rations, and even 1980s Wall Street boardrooms.

But we won’t stop at history. We'll dive deep into the science behind cocaine's addictive grip on the brain, the dangerous methods of use, its medical applications, and the modern public health crisis it continues to fuel. Finally, we shine a light on recovery and hope, with resources for those battling addiction today.

This episode is a powerful blend of anthropology, pharmacology, history, and humanity. Whether you're here to learn, reflect, or share—this is a story that connects ancient wisdom with modern complexity.
